a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orSharlatan Hellseher <sharlatanus@gmail.com>2024-04-16 15:11:44 +0100
committerSharlatan Hellseher <sharlatanus@gmail.com>2024-04-30 21:36:10 +0100
commit51446076cafb375d7115fc455abf813643c322d6 (patch)
treeeeea218bb0b137c15aa41114a2b5a5b26e6356d8
parent8cea282efe5caf9dda2980422e789a7e013b816a (diff)
downloadguix-51446076cafb375d7115fc455abf813643c322d6.tar.gz
guix-51446076cafb375d7115fc455abf813643c322d6.zip
gnu: python-asdf: Update to 3.2.0.
* gnu/packages/astronomy.scm (python-asdf): Update to 3.2.0. [arguments] <#:phases>: Replace 'fix-tests-setup with 'patch-pyprojectct-toml phase and add one more substitution rule. [propagated-inputs]: Remove python-asdf-unit-schemas. Change-Id: I9e7a0282ed0a9eb82a20988762792e10ae33496b
-rw-r--r--gnu/packages/astronomy.scm16
1 files changed, 9 insertions, 7 deletions
diff --git a/gnu/packages/astronomy.scm b/gnu/packages/astronomy.scm
index a558e0bbac..9ca12dd9e9 100644
--- a/gnu/packages/astronomy.scm
+++ b/gnu/packages/astronomy.scm
@@ -4418,13 +4418,13 @@ between image and reference catalogs. Currently only aligning images with
(define-public python-asdf
(package
(name "python-asdf")
- (version "3.1.0")
+ (version "3.2.0")
(source
(origin
(method url-fetch)
(uri (pypi-uri "asdf" version))
(sha256
- (base32 "0fa6y3gmqc0y3nz0h68vq3a84pvx6gc5zp33wg8a4n9b4kipm464"))))
+ (base32 "1wj556g15gwp6ir5hg083l15sifdsf23giqkx0jbn4lgdwjffbgr"))))
(build-system pyproject-build-system)
(arguments
(list
@@ -4432,12 +4432,15 @@ between image and reference catalogs. Currently only aligning images with
#~(list "-n" "auto" "-p" "no:legacypath")
#:phases
#~(modify-phases %standard-phases
- ;; ImportError: Error importing plugin " no:legacypath": No module
- ;; named ' no:legacypath'
- (add-before 'check 'fix-tests-setup
+ (add-after 'unpack 'patch-pypojrect-toml
(lambda _
(substitute* "pyproject.toml"
- ((".*:legacypath.*") "")))))))
+ ;; ImportError: Error importing plugin " no:legacypath": No
+ ;; module named ' no:legacypath'
+ ((".*:legacypath.*") "")
+ ;; TypeError: Configuration.__init__() got an unexpected
+ ;; keyword argument 'version_file'
+ (("version_file = \"asdf/_version.py\"") "")))))))
(native-inputs
(list python-fsspec
python-packaging
@@ -4451,7 +4454,6 @@ between image and reference catalogs. Currently only aligning images with
(propagated-inputs
(list python-asdf-standard
python-asdf-transform-schemas
- python-asdf-unit-schemas
python-attrs ;; for vendorized jsonschema
python-importlib-metadata
python-jmespath